Blaze currently lives near Lucknow. He loves to run around his fenced yard and watch the world go by.
He was taken in as a youngster from his owner in 2003 after he had been in the Zurich pound repeatedly for running at large because he was intact and untrained - they got him from someone as payment for towing them. Clearly his owners were not bright enough to match a husky's wits.
He has been living with dogs and cats since then. He also likes kids.
Unfortunately - in the fall of '08 he was attacked by a deaf dog and bitten badly. His wounds were too deep to stitch. He has healed very well and his hair is all grown back.
Blaze was abused in his original home and he is sure he will be hit after all this time. Anyone looking to adopt him must be an experienced siberian husky owner as he will try to outwit anyone he can. They also must be willing to enroll him in obedience training to help strengthen the bond between you and him, socialize him with new male dogs in a controlled environment and get on the same page with training commands and expectations.
He is sure he will not be fed - so he will guard or eat everyone's share of the food. He will often try to take everyone's treats and toys - as many as he can fit in his mouth.
He loves food so much that he will literally catch it in mid air to avoid the risk of not getting it. He often looks like a seagull eating a fish if he finds anything other than dog food to eat - as he gulps it without chewing to ensure he does not miss out.
Blaze is housetrained - if supervised - but will mark if not supervised. He is cratetrained and will go right in when told to.
For his mental well-being - ideally he should go to a home where he can be the only dog, or even better the only animal - so then he can be spoiled as the only dog. Since the attack - living with multiple dogs seems to be a constant strain on his mind as he is absolutely sure he will not get his share of food - even though he always does.
He knows to sit and shake a paw and other paw and lay down. He rides well in the car.
He is excellent getting groomed.
He is excellent in the car.
He enjoys running around the 6 foot high back yard with other dogs all day long. He could not go to a home without a fully fenced yard as he will run off as fast as he can, if given the opportunity.

When Nikita came into our care, we thought she was really up there in age. After watching her for a few days, we felt there was something just not right with her and that her obesity wasn't because of food consumption. We had some blood tests done and found she has a bad thyroid. Dr. Pet Vet put her on some pretty blue pills and she began to loose weight in record time. She began to walk faster, breathe easier and stand to eat instead of falling asleep in her dish. She recently went back for more blood work to make sure the med dosage was right and we found she has lost an amazing 40 pounds since we first posted her a few months ago. We updated her shots since we felt she now has her condition under control and she is spayed. Just to be on the safe side we also did a Heartworm test which is negative. She will require her Heartworm meds for the season , which are also inexpensive in comparison to the costs of curing her of heartworm should she contract it . Our vet has her at maybe 5-6 years old and her heart is sound even after carrying around all that tonnage. She still has to loose between 20-30 pounds but that will happen on its own with regular, moderate exercise and her meds which ,by the way, are very inexpensive. She`ll have lots to take home with her . Did we mention why we brought her into care? Her owners were going to euthanize her because she wouldn't play anymore. Well, she not only plays, she can shake a paw, scratch where it itches and walks well on leash if you can keep up to her. She`s happy to be here and shows it by sitting on a foot with her back to her person waiting to be touched. She isn't destructive so sleeps on her blanket at night beside the bed. When its time to get up, she sticks a wet nose into her persons face to let them know she`s `gotta` go. Nikita gets along very well with dogs her age and size and seems to care less about the cats. She hasn't been kid tested but we think she would be fine with older children, 10+. We gave Nikita another chance, now its your turn. She has many more good years to live and love.
